CVE-2026-46047

CVE-2026-46047: In the Linux kernel, net: qrtr: ns use-after-free in driver remove is fixed. The vulnerability arises if a packet arrives after destroy_workqueue() but before sock_release(), causing qrtr_ns_data_ready() to queue a work item that dereferences freed memory. CVE-2026-45898

The CVE-2026-45898 issue affects the Linux kernel’s RDMA/iwcm component, where flawed work submission logic could cause queue_work() to queue items that are still live, enabling a work item to be processed and freed while still on the workqueue and triggering list corruption.
